  • Today I will be showing you how to install the electrical relay on your Kawasaki Vulcan S step-by-step. This is a very easy installation and only requires a few basic hand tools. You will need to install the electrical relay on the Vulcan S if you want to install the 12 volt adapter, extra bar lights, or gear indicator. This is not an expensive product from Kawasaki and it is very easy to do at home, so don't waste your money at the dealership on this one!
    ►Tools you need for this job:
    Rachet wrench
    10 mm socket
    11mm socket
    Small ratchet extension bar
    3mm Allen key or hex key

    Great Video. This might be a little off topic, but what exactly does the Relay do? I googled this question relative to the Vulcan S and did not get an answer. I want to add this power adapter and eventually an upgraded tail light that allows one to delete the stock plastic fender extender and the rear turn signals.
    When reading about that modification, it noted a relay was needed so the new integrated turn signal will flash at the correct speed. Will this one relay serve both modifications? I know zero about electrical, so any information would be appreciated.

    • @chrisatbucknell
      @chrisatbucknell 3 ปีที่แล้ว

      The relay should put power to other circuits only when ignition is on, rather than a straight draw from battery that would otherwise always be on. For new tail lights, if you are going with LEDs, you need to replace the flasher relay with one that functions for LEDs. LEDs are lower wattage so existing flasher relay does not work properly - you will get "hyper flash" if you use LED signals and stock flasher relay.
